The Hole In The Ground is a new Irish horror film and stars..Irish people. The film takes place in a forest and follows a mom and her son who live in a run down country house. While there, strange occurrences begin to occur leading the mother to believe her sons strange behaviour has something to do with a large hole in their nearby forest. I only saw this film like last week and overall, I don't have much to say. The Hole In the Ground is a solid horror film. I don't know if I would watch it again anytime soon but I did enjoy it, it was creepy, entertaining and had good acting. I don't think it should be getting as much praise, apart from it being the best Irish horror film, which it is, only because there's only like two Irish horror films hat I know of; Grabbers and Nails. Anywho, The Hole In The Ground is a solid, decent horror film that I do recommend but don't waste money buying it, just watch it online or rent it.
Michael Jackson is my life. I have been obsessed with him since I was 6 years old after my friend introduced me to him. I collected his cds, watched all his short music videos and watched his films (Moonwalker, This Is It). He was always my favourite singer. Then, I heard about this documentary and something struck me and told me I should watch it when it premiered on Channel 4. Wow.
I've always suspected Michael Jackson to be a bit strange with his whole creation of Neverland and his enjoyment of spending time with kids, but I did always believe that this was because he didn't want children to miss out on their childhood like he did. And now I don't really know what to think. Do I believe Michael Jackson is a sexual predator? Do I believe what these two boys are saying? I do believe Michael Jackson isn't innocent of all charges, but I don't think he was mentally well. Maybe it was his childhood traumas that played such a haunting role in his life, that eventually took over him. Do I still like Michael Jackson? Of course. But I don't think as much. I feel Michael Jackson fans will never feel the same if they do decide to watch this, just like me. I just don't think I'll ever feel normal with Michael Jackson again, but I will probably still listen to his music.
There's my review of Leaving Neverland. "Hard to watch, tough to ignore, impossible to forget"

Just before Christmas the pass of 2018, Bird Box, a survival horror film was released on Netflix with astonishing reviews from critics and audiences, and as a horror fan, it was a great horror film to be the last of 2018. The plot has been polarized everywhere so I won't explain it, also because its a bit of a spoiler. But the cast including Sandra Bullock and Sarah Paulson were all amazing in their roles. The ending was also a nice and light ending for the film. Bird Box was definitely one of the best horror films of 2018, and definitely in the top three with Bird Box, The Strangers: Prey At Night and Unsane (or Hereditary)!
